Michael Brown To Lead Smithfield Subsidiary Farmland

October 13, 2010 Smithfield Foods, Inc.

Smithfield Foods, Inc. today announced that it has named Michael E. Brown president and chief operating officer of Farmland Foods, Inc., effective October 4, 2010. Farmland is a subsidiary of Smithfield Foods, head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ri.
